Mejores programas para crear juegos | 2024

Mejores programas para crear juegos | 2024

¿Tienes una idea para un nuevo videojuego? Te muestro los mejores programas para crear juegos y lenguajes de programación para conocer

Desde hace algún tiempo, la idea de hacer un videojuego ha estado flotando en tu cabeza y te preguntas qué necesitas para hacerlo.

Primero necesitas dos cosas básicas:

  • software de desarrollo de juegos
  • conocimiento de un lenguaje de programación

Hay muchos software para hacer videojuegos del más alto nivel, y suelen ser gratuitos para uso privado o en cualquier caso tienen costos muy bajos para desarrolladores independientes. Este software te permite armar todas las piezas del rompecabezas que componen un videojuego, como gráficos, modelos 2D / 3D y lo más importante, la parte lógica del juego. Para que tu juego funcione, para que tu personaje camine, salte o dispare, debes conocer al menos un lenguaje de programación.







Como veremos más adelante, el idioma a utilizar depende del programa para crear juegos que uses.

índice

¿Qué lenguaje de programación? - Mejores programas para crear juegos

C

C es un lenguaje de programación imperativo de naturaleza procedimental, lanzado en 1972. Los programas escritos en este lenguaje están compuestos por expresiones matemáticas e instrucciones imperativas agrupadas en procedimientos parametrizados capaces de manipular diferentes tipos de datos.




C + +

C + + es probablemente el lenguaje de programación más utilizado actualmente en la creación de videojuegos. Aunque es un lenguaje complicado de aprender, tiene ventajas sobre otros lenguajes, como el control directo del hardware y los procesos gráficos, que son muy importantes en el desarrollo de un videojuego.




C + + es un lenguaje orientado a objetos (OOP), lo que significa que puede utilizar estructuras internas para organizar mejor su código en bloques reutilizables (clases y objetos). C + + es un derivado de C, sin embargo los dos tienen muchas diferencias e incompatibilidades, que se han incrementado a lo largo de los años.

C#

C # es otro lenguaje muy popular, más fácil de aprender que C ++. Su profundo conocimiento es útil en la creación de videojuegos de cualquier tipo y para cualquier arquitectura. Como en el caso de C ++, este lenguaje de programación desarrollado por Microsoft también está orientado a objetos (POO).

Java

Java juega un papel importante en la industria de los videojuegos. Utiliza los mismos principios de programación orientada a objetos que C ++, pero a diferencia de este último, está diseñado para ser lo más independiente posible de la plataforma de ejecución. Y también uno de los lenguajes principales para desarrollar juegos para Android, gracias también al creciente número de módulos y bibliotecas de terceros.



Phyton

Phyton es uno de los lenguajes de programación del momento, gracias a su sencillez y versatilidad. Este lenguaje ofrece a los desarrolladores técnicas de programación orientada a objetos (OOP), al igual que C ++ y Java. Gracias a Pygame, un conjunto de módulos Phyton, puede crear un prototipo de sus videojuegos rápidamente.



Los mejores programas para crear juegos

Unity: los mejores programas para crear juegos

La Unidad es un motor gráfico multiplataforma ampliamente utilizado para la creación de videojuegos. Para utilizar Unity es necesario tener conocimientos de C#, que también se puede adquirir a través de i tutoriales ofrecido por la propia Unidad.




Unity admite activos creados en 3ds Max, Maya, Blender y otro software similar, además de ofrecer un gran catálogo de gráficos, modelos y texturas de alta calidad, tanto gratuitos como de pago.Además de las versiones de pago Plus y Pro, Unity también es disponible en versión gratuita, para cualquiera con un Ingresos de videojuegos por debajo de $ 100,000 / año.



Unreal Engine 4 - Los mejores programas para crear juegos

4 Unreal Engine es el motor gráfico de Epic Games, conocido por juegos como Fortnite y Unreal Tournament. Una de las cosas que hacen que Unreal Engine 4 sea único es el Sistema de secuencias de comandos visual, que le permite desarrollar rápidamente la lógica de sus juegos sin escribir una línea de código. Para aquellos que se sienten cómodos con la programación clásica, pueden usarla sin ningún problema. C + +.

Como ocurre con la mayoría de los programas para crear juegos actuales, Unreal Engine también le permite exportar sus creaciones a PC, consolas, teléfonos inteligentes y sistemas de realidad virtual. Su modelo de pago prevé lauso gratuito del software en comparación con pago de una regalía del 5% de la facturación, si esta supera los $ 3,000 cada 3 meses. En el transcurso de 2021 el versión 5 de Unreal Ungine, que trae varias innovaciones muy importantes.




GameMaker Studio 2: los mejores programas para crear juegos

Desarrollado por la casa de software YoYo Games, GameMaker Studio 2 está disponible en el mercado desde hace 3 años. Gracias a sus características y su interfaz de arrastrar y soltar para crear variables y lógica de juego, se considera uno de los mejores programas para principiantes. En cualquier caso, tener un conocimiento básico de C puede ser útil para programar escenarios más complejos. GameMaker Studio 2 no es gratis. Hay 3 versiones (Creator, Developer y Console), con los precios comienzan en $ 39, y puede probarlo gratis durante 30 días antes de comprar.

Añade un comentario de Mejores programas para crear juegos | 2024
¡Comentario enviado con éxito! Lo revisaremos en las próximas horas.